At 03:15 AM 6/27/2002, Crist J. Clark wrote:
> # chflags -R 0 /filesystem/path
>
>Before a restore(8) is fairly trivial.
But restore does not set all the flags again.
So you either have to loose some flags or some file changes if you
restore a multi level backup.
Or you restore the flags manually.
I can't believe this. What am I missing?
